Roll Covers in Soft-Nip Calendering and Supercalendering, 1995 Finishing and Converting Conference Proceedings

Jose J. A. Rodal, Ph.D.

Rodal Engineering

What are the limitations of polymer covers used in soft-nip calendering? Why have polymer covers reportedly taken 25% of the available positions in U.S. supercalenders away from conventional cotton-filled rolls? How long can these polymer covers run between re-finishings of the cover’s surface and what is the physical phenomenon responsible for this limitation?

These and other issues such as: mark resistance, cover failures, roll grinding and dubbing, speed, and temperature effects are discussed.
